Here is where Telltale Games and their TWD game come into play. Mindlessly gunning downs waves of the undead can be amusing, but a standalone game revolving around zombies should be more than that. In my opinion, more developers should follow in Telltale's footsteps and use the zombies as a narrative device, rather than just arbitrary obstacles or enemy. The zombie apocalypse is about people who would normally never interact with each other being forced into situations where they must depend on one another. There's also the emotional impact of seeing people the characters', and even the player, once knew being turned into an undead horror and the need to put them down. This leaves so many possibilities for character development that I'm surprised Telltale has been the only developer, to my knowledge, that actually utilized that.
